Anonymous5 - You could use something like the attached pbix file. There are several steps to consider with this solution:
- Create a Date table with an M (Power Query) script.
- Use a lookup table to identify the previous event.
- In the PO table:
- Unpivot the dates - this will allow you to easily compare values within a single measure.
- Find the next event date by looking up the previous event, and merging table with itself.
- Do the same for "days since create date".
- Calculate the number of days between event and previous event, and created date to event.
- Create a parameters table to allow user to choose between analyzing
- Days from creation to event or days since previous event.
- Which event's date (for instance, quarter) is being analyzed - create, previous event, or event.
- Create an Event lookup table, with the purpose of ordering the events.
- Create relationships between the Date table and PO table, and between the Event table and the PO table.
- Create measures which take into account the selections from the Parameters table.
- Create the visualizations
Note: The parameters table could be eliminated and the measures simplified, if only a single type of analysis makes sense.
